Indie is a very broad term for music. It once just described music that was made outside of labels, but now it\u2019s an entire musical genre being made in bedrooms on budgets and major studios for big labels. There are several different sub-genres of Indie that sometimes get confused with each other. Like Bedroom Pop, Indie Pop, Dream Pop, Lo-Fi, etc. Today, I\u2019ll try to clarify these terms (as well as any subjective classification can be clarified) and attempt to explain the differences between them.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
